Alberto G. Laurenzana, Jr, 66, peacefully passed away on Sunday, August 6, 2017 in Houston, Texas. He was born September 1, 1950 in Houston, Texas to Alberto G. Laurenzana, Sr. and Irene Gonzales Laurenzana. He was preceded in death by his father. Albert is survived by his daughters, Loraine Laurenzana Perez and Allison Laurenzana; mother, Irene Laurenzana; sisters, Ninfa Ortiz and husband Ralph and Liz Laurenzana Trevino; a host of nieces, nephews, relatives and friends. The family will receive friends on Thursday August 10, 2017 from 5-9 PM with the Recitation of the Holy Rosary at 7 PM at Forest Park Lawndale Funeral Home. A Graveside service will be held at 10:30 AM, Friday, August 11, 2017 at the Houston National Cemetery.
